    Troops disrupt bandits’ meetings, destroys camps in Taraba

    Published on

    Troops of the 6 Brigade Nigerian Army, operating under Sector 3 of Operation Whirl Stroke (OPWS) have conducted a successful intelligence-driven operation, dismantling multiple bandit hideouts and recovering critical logistics in Taraba State.

    In a statement by the Acting Assistant Director, Army Public Relations, Capt Olubodunde Oni, 6 Brigade Nigerian Army, said that the operation, which was carried out tat the weekend, targeted a suspected meeting convened by Liamdoo Douglas Adekpe, alias Bajor, a wanted notorious bandit leader, in the southern part of Wukari Local Government Area.

    “Acting on credible intelligence, the troops launched a swift and aggressive offensive in remote areas identified as strongholds of the Bajor-led syndicate. Upon arrival, the criminals, sensing imminent danger, fled, abandoning valuable items.

    “The operation resulted in the destruction of key hideouts used for coordinating attacks and harbouring weapons. Troops recovered five operational motorcycles, suspected to have been used for rapid movement and raids on surrounding communities,” said.

    The Commander of 6 Brigade and Sector 3 OPWS, Brigadier General Kingsley Chidiebere Uwa, stated that although Bajor and his cohorts narrowly escaped, troops remain on high alert and are actively tracking their movements.

    He underscored the Nigerian Army’s unwavering commitment to pursuing and neutralising criminal elements, threatening the peace and security of law-abiding citizens in Taraba State and beyond.

    Uwa called on residents to continue providing timely and actionable information to security agencies to support ongoing operations.

    He reaffirmed the Brigade’s resolve to sustain pressure on terrorist enclaves, employing both kinetic and non-kinetic approaches to ensure lasting peace and stability in the region.
